The HTC Hero sports a 3.2 touchscreen display offering 320 x 480
resolution boasting a fingerprint resistant coating to keep those
unsightly smears to a minimum and as well as offering GSM and HSDPA
connectivity the HTC Hero comes with Wi-Fi, integrated GPS, Google
application integration (naturally - this is an Android phone after all)
as well as a 5 megapixel camera and microSD memory card support.
An additional highlight which is causing somewhat of a stir comes in the
form of HTC's new HTC Sense UI which, if its presense on the Hero is
anything to go by, appears to be set to supersede HTC's TouchFLO 3D UI -
though, obviously, time will tell as to whether TouchFLO has indeed been
cast aside (already).
As far as Orange UK is concerned, reports suggest that the HTC Hero will
be offered from early July and, interestingly, will be offered for free
on a number of as yet unspecified price plans.
